Every year the Redemptorists celebrate the great sacrifice of Ukrainian Redemptorists for their witness to the Catholic faith.  May their martyrdom bear the fruits of love, joy, and peace.

Pope John Paul II beatified a group of modern martyrs of the Ukrainian Catholic Church on June 27, 2001. Among them were four Redemptorists: Bishop Mykolay (Nicholas) Charnetsky (1884-1959), Bishop Vasyl (Basil) Vsevolod Velychkovsky (1903-1973), Father Ivan Ziatyk (1899-1952), and Father Zynoviy (Zenon) Kovalyk (1903-1941).

All of these men endured sufferings and torture inflicted either during World War II or after it, during the era of Soviet control prior to the independence of Ukraine in 1991. Bishop Nicholas Charnetsky and his twenty-four companions represent a glorious era of martyrdom for the Ukrainian Catholic Church, and their stories give great witness to the strength of their Catholic faith.
